Nej' stands at the forefront of a musical movement that redefines urban pop, drawing listeners into an intimate exploration of contemporary experiences. By weaving personal narratives and societal reflections into her sound, she provides a voice for those navigating the complexities of modern life, creating resonance in a cultural landscape yearning for authenticity and connection. Her ability to capture the pulse of urban existence has made her an influential figure, inspiring a new generation of artists to embrace vulnerability in their music. In her creative process, Nej' employs a masterful blend of production techniques and emotive vocal delivery, crafting tracks that pulse with both energy and introspection. She often collaborates with producers who enhance her vision, allowing for a rich sonic environment that mirrors the emotional weight of her lyrics. This collaborative spirit not only enriches her sound but also fosters a sense of community among listeners who relate deeply to the shared themes explored in her work. Nej' often explores love, identity, and resilience through a lens that balances sincerity with an understated irony. Her storytelling approach is both conversational and impressionistic, inviting listeners into her world while leaving space for personal interpretation. The tone oscillates between reflective moments and upbeat expressions, creating an engaging contrast that keeps audiences invested in her journey.
